Long-time existence of nonlinear inhomogeneous compressible elastic waves

Abstract

In this paper, we consider the nonlinear inhomogeneous compressible elastic waves in three spatial dimensions when the density is a small disturbance around a constant state. In homogeneous case, the almost global existence was established by Klainerman-Sideris [1996CPAM], and global existence was built by Agemi [2000Invent. Math.] and Sideris [1996Invent. Math., 2000Ann. Math.] independently. Here we establish the corresponding almost global and global existence theory in the inhomogeneous case.
